Transaction 28a214da86f5e8ecbd73ca71b590905ceec83d6ad5c6f16106cc8d13190ab5ac

5 Input
2 Outputs
  • 28a214da86f5e8ecbd73ca71b590905ceec83d6ad5c6f16106cc8d13190ab5ac:0
  • value  375723
    address  16huA1eJjtpRg4jPXaJamVTFbAsS62wgqj
  • 28a214da86f5e8ecbd73ca71b590905ceec83d6ad5c6f16106cc8d13190ab5ac:1
  • value  132557000
    address  3P9J3qgLiY1d2L5ZEWzxNUt1ab1QR7Bh4v